Woodturning - Next level up-cycling, bed frame to bowl

The wood for this bowl has come from an old bed frame. Secondlife Recrafted, a great small business on the Central Coast of New South Wales sources a large range of timber. They up-cycle that timber into a range of hand made products including chopping and serving boards, bottle openers and pens to name a few. Recently they contacted me to see if I could use a couple of blanks to make some bowls for them. This the first of a number I will be making for them.
This timber, Queensland Maple, came from a retired cabinet maker named Terry who was based in South West Sydney. There was a bit of tear out as I turned the bowl, but after shear scraping I was able to get the rest out with some sanding. I have left the bowl unfinished as Secondlife Recrafted want to apply their own to it. The bowl is about 30 cm in diameter and 9cm deep. Thank you to SecondLife for this bowl blank.
